Online Training

For your convenience, the Department offers a rich resource of web based GIS training. Online courses include an introduction to GIS topics, hands-on exercises, a test to assess newly acquired skills, and a certificate issued upon completion of the course. These classes are made available through the ESRI Virtual Campus.

The Virtual Campus offers a wealth of information on GIS technology, applications, and science. The Department purchased a subscription, so there is ready access to a variety of courses. In-depth courses such as Learning ArcGIS or Understanding Geographic Data can take 18-24 hours to complete, while smaller workshops on specific topics such as Labeling in ArcMap and Customizing ArcMap may take only 2-4 hours to complete.
